Detailed description of the invention
Be clearly and completely described to the technical scheme in the utility model embodiment below, obviously, described embodiment is only a part of embodiment of the present utility model, instead of whole embodiments.Based on the embodiment in the utility model, those of ordinary skill in the art are not making other embodiments all obtained under creative work prerequisite, all belong to the scope of the utility model protection.
Refer to Fig. 1-5, the utility model embodiment comprises:
A kind of wrapping mold based on automobile metal folder, it comprises: the first spring 1, slotting tool 2, drive block 3, contour cover 4, second spring 5, shaping base 6, forming core rod 7, plug clamping plate 8 and bound edge drift 9, drive block and forming core rod is promoted by slotting tool, finally according to the planform of forming core rod and bound edge groove, product is carried out shaping and bound edge, the volume of the mould reduced as much as possible, make the structure of mould more simple, easy to use and produce, and use bound edge groove and forming core rod simultaneously, the shape of product can be made more accurate, place distortion, ensure the quality of product.
Described plug clamping plate 8 comprise train wheel bridge and lower plate.
Described plug clamping plate are arranged on the sidewall of described drive block, and described lower plate is fixed on the bottom of described drive block by described second spring.
Described contour cover is connected with described first spring, and described drive block is movably connected on described contourly to put, and described drive block is movable connection with described first spring.
The top of described drive block is provided with the first inclined-plane, and the direction on described first inclined-plane is towards the first spring, described slotting tool is arranged on described drive block, and the bottom of described slotting tool is provided with second inclined-plane agreed with described first inclined-plane, described slotting tool is provided with a punch press, described punch press is when pressed status, and described slotting tool is connected with described contour cover downwards along the first inclined-plane, and described slotting tool is arranged between described first spring and described drive block.
Described shaping base is arranged at the side of described drive block, and described bound edge drift is arranged at directly over described shaping base, and described bound edge drift and described shaping base are movable connection.
The top of described shaping base is provided with U-type groove 10, and the bottom of described bound edge drift is provided with a deep-slotted chip breaker 11 matched with described U-type groove, and described U-type groove and described deep-slotted chip breaker form a bound edge groove for product orientation and sizing.
One end of described forming core rod and described drive block with regulate the described plug clamping plate of described forming core rod position and be connected, the other end of described forming core rod is movably connected in described bound edge groove, the shape of described forming core rod and the matching form of described bound edge groove close, and the diameter of described forming core rod is less than the diameter of described bound edge groove.
The concrete use step of described a kind of wrapping mold based on automobile metal folder comprises:
1. during reset condition, drive block and slotting tool link together according to the first inclined-plane and the second inclined-plane, at this moment, select suitable forming core rod, utilize the second spring and plug clamping plate to regulate position and the height of forming core rod, one end of forming core rod is fixed on drive block according to demand the most at last, simultaneously, the bottom of product is placed in U-type groove, product needs the part of bound edge aim at deep-slotted chip breaker;
2. drive punching machine presses, the second inclined-plane of slotting tool constantly slides to the right downwards along the first inclined-plane, until slotting tool sticks between drive block and the first spring, and the bottom of slotting tool with contour overlap be connected till;
3. in slotting tool constantly downslide process, drive block is promoted left gradually by slotting tool, leaves the first spring, and drive block drives forming core rod to be moved to the left, in the product that forming core rod one end is arranged in U-type groove;
4. utilize the forcing press be connected with bound edge drift, by bound edge drift slowly to pressing down, in the process constantly pressed down, deep-slotted chip breaker will product can need the partial depression of bound edge bend according to the shape of himself gradually, until the bottom surface of bound edge drift is connected with the end face of shaping base, and the part of product needed bound edge is pressed on forming core rod by deep-slotted chip breaker, this completes bound edge sizing.
